Always-on heater good for 2.5 gallon and up betta tanks
I currently use two of these for two 2.5 gallon betta tanks. The most important thing to know about these heaters are that they do not shut off! They continuously heat the tank just like a simple space heater in a room. Eventually the water in the tank will reach a steady temperature. The final temperature of the tank is primarily based off of 1) The size of the tanks and 2) The temperature of the surrounding air. If you keep your room on the cooler side (roughly 66-70 degrees Fahrenheit) this heater should heat a roughly 2.5 gallon tank to a high-70s/low-80s temperature which is perfect for a betta. It could also work for a larger tank in a warmer room. Aqueon also produces 5, 7.5, and 15 watt heaters for different tank parameters.Other notes:- Extremely compact design- One of my heaters runs about 1 degrees F warmer, though this amount of variation isn't an issue for me.

It’s a hit and miss. Be around when you turn it on.
I ordered 2 of these for my 5 gal betta tanks. I have 2 more of these at home that I use for my other betta tanks. These things are a hit and miss really. One came non working, the other heated my 5 gal tank to 82f. The non working one I’m returning for a replacement. The working one that wants to boil my betta I’ve placed into one of my 10 gal tanks and now it keeps it at a stable 78. If you are going to use these, please remember to let it sit in your tank for a few hours before plugging it in. Then only do so when you are available to monitor the temperature change. These things DO NOT shut off. They just keep heating. I do not suggest these heaters for tanks smaller then 5 gals. They seem to function best in my 7 gals aquariums.
